## Limits and quotas — catalogue import

The Marrowfield catalogue importer accepts batch files from branch systems. To bound resource use and limit abuse, each upload is checked against hard caps on record count, file size, and concurrent jobs before parsing begins. These caps are enforced server-side and defined by the following constants.

tuning table, faduf-baduf:
PRIORITIES = {
    "ulavan": 191,
    "silys": 750,
    "goriel": 238,
    "kelmir": 66,
    "wendor": 432,
}

For the support team: the printer-spooler microservice setting `SPOOL_AUTH_MODE` has been renamed to `SPOOLER_SECURITY_PROFILE`. Tickets referencing the old name should be updated; the service logs a warning but still honors the legacy key until the next major release. Queue behavior, retry counts, and the 15-minute stale-job sweep are unchanged. Customers running self-hosted instances will also need to re-issue their spooler token after upgrading, since the profile change invalidates old ones, and set it in the env file with this line:

env line for fafof-fahag: LEDGER_TOKEN5=f8790

## Formula sandbox tuning

User-supplied formulas in Gridmoor execute inside a restricted interpreter with hard ceilings on time, memory, and call depth. Reviewers should confirm any change to these ceilings is justified in the PR description, since raising them widens the abuse surface. Defaults were chosen from production traces. The current limits are as follows.

limits module of tafog-fawip:
WEIGHTS = {
    "julix": 57,
    "lamys": 992,
    "kasvan": 209,
    "quenok": 750,
    "alddor": 259,
    "oliath": 1009,
    "wenix": 815,
}